Transaction 6afda11ee48070b853cb559a96d9fe1b5b68594432d09073e030655cffb61934

2 Input
1 Outputs
  • 6afda11ee48070b853cb559a96d9fe1b5b68594432d09073e030655cffb61934:0
  • value  38911398
    address  1CPFYtk8rCBmeX4595zWmrYNo2twzK5K29